Completely agreed and definitely something we're trying to get implemented (or something similar).

Lack of information, as you know, is THE biggest problem with trying to provide assistance.

Until we get something like that implemented, I'm taking a bit more aggressive approach to threads that do not provide the necessary details right off the bat. Obviously given that I'm not here 24 hours a day we're going to miss a lot of them, but I'm hoping that by doing so with the ones I can get to people will start to see them and 'get the message'.

For anyone reading this that is wondering 'why isn't my support question getting answered' - did you provide ALL the details asked for and/or do any of the troubleshooting indicated in those threads?

I think its a great idea, too. And I'm glad that Digitech support is on it!

One additional suggestion I have would be to make the search features of the Avid knowledge base a bit more user friendly. I often find it difficult to find something and it is usually because I'm not using the exactly correct search terms. If I as an experienced PT user run into that, its gotta be worse for a newbie. Maybe have some kind of front end that lists in plain English all the common error messages, and then have options to click here if you are running Win XP, here for Win 7, Here for Mac etc etc. Might make it easier to find the right articles.
